Brigham Young University - Provo tops the 2021 list of our schools in Utah that are best for non-traditional history students. BYU is a very large private not-for-profit school located in the city of Provo. In addition to being on our best for non-traditional students list, BYU has also earned the #1 rank in our Best Colleges for History in Utah ranking.

The school has a low student loan default rate of 0.4%. There are approximately 12,325 students at BYU that take at least one class online. 4,504 students are part time.

Utah State University landed the #2 spot in our 2021 best history schools for non-traditional students. USU is a fairly large public school located in the city of Logan. USU not only placed well in our non-traditional rankings. It is also #2 on our Best Colleges for History in Utah list.

The school has a low student loan default rate of 0.8%. Approximately 13,751 students take at least one class online at USU. About 9,734 of the students at USU are attending part time.

Utah Valley University earned the #3 spot in our 2021 rankings. Located in the city of Orem, UVU is a public school with a very large student population. UVU also took the #4 spot in our Best Colleges for History in Utah rankings.

About 1.1% of UVU students default on their loans in three years, which is lower than average. Approximately 15,690 students take at least one class online at UVU. There are roughly 22,387 part time students in attendance at UVU.

The #4 spot in this year's ranking belongs to Southern Utah University. Located in the town of Cedar City, Southern Utah University is a public school with a large student population. Southern Utah University not only placed well in our non-traditional rankings. It is also #3 on our Best Colleges for History in Utah list.

The school has a low student loan default rate of 2.0%. There are approximately 4,613 students at Southern Utah University that take at least one class online. 4,998 students are part time.
